Late-onset Crohn's disease: a comparison of disease behaviour and therapy with younger adult patients: the Italian Group for the Study of Inflammator…

2019

BACKGROUND Disease phenotype and outcome of late-onset Crohn's disease are still poorly defined. METHODS In this Italian nationwide multicentre retrospective study, patients diagnosed ≥65 years (late-onset) were compared with young adult-onset with 16-39 years and adult-onset Crohn's disease 40-64 years. Data were collected for 3 years following diagnosis. RESULTS A total of 631 patients (late-onset 153, adult-onset 161, young adult-onset 317) were included. Colonic disease was more frequent in late-onset (P < 0005), stenosing behaviour was more frequent than in adult-onset (P < 0003), but fistulising disease was uncommon. Double Drug Delivery Using Capped Mesoporous Silica Microparticles for the Effective Treatment of Inflammatory Bowel Disease

2019

[EN] Silica mesoporous microparticles loaded with both rhodamine B fluorophore (S1) or hydrocortisone (S2), and capped with an olsalazine derivative, are prepared and fully characterized. Suspensions of Si and S2 in water at an acidic and a neutral pH show negligible dye/drug release, yet a notable delivery took place when the reducing agent sodium dithionite is added because of hydrolysis of an azo bond in the capping ensemble. Additionally, olsalazine fragmentation induced 5-aminosalicylic acid (5-ASA) release. Inflammation and Aortic Pulse Wave Velocity: A Multicenter Longitudinal Study in Patients With Inflammatory Bowel Disease

2019

Background Inflammatory bowel disease ( IBD ) is characterized by a low prevalence of traditional risk factors, an increased aortic pulse‐wave velocity ( aPWV ), and an excess of cardiovascular events. We have previously hypothesized that the cardiovascular risk excess reported in these patients could be explained by chronic inflammation. Here, we tested the hypothesis that chronic inflammation is responsible for the increased aPWV previously reported in IBD patients and that anti‐TNFa (anti‐tumor necrosis factor‐alpha) therapy reduce aPWV in these patients. Local barrier dysfunction identified by confocal laser endomicroscopy predicts relapse in inflammatory bowel disease

2011

Objectives: Loss of intestinal barrier function plays an important role in the pathogenesis of inflammatory bowel disease (IBD). Shedding of intestinal epithelial cells is a potential cause of barrier loss during inflammation. The objectives of the study were (1) to determine whether cell shedding and barrier loss in humans can be detected by confocal endomicroscopy and (2) whether these parameters predict relapse of IBD. Methods: Confocal endomicroscopy was performed in IBD and control patients using intravenous fluorescein to determine the relationship between cell shedding and local barrier dysfunction. A novel rat model of chronic fibrosing cholangitis induced by local administration of a hapten reagent into the dilated bile duct is associated with …

2000

Abstract Background/Aim: The cholangiopathies represent hepatobiliary diseases in which bile-duct epithelial cells are targets for destructive processes, including immune-mediated damage. We describe a novel rat model of chronic fibrosing cholangitis induced by administration of the hapten reagent 2,4,6-trinitrobenzenesulfonic acid (TNBS) into the dilated bile duct. Methods: The common bile duct was dilated due to a mild stenosis in 8-week-old female Lewis rats. TNBS (50 mg/kg) was injected during a second laparotomy. Involvement of the P2X7 purinergic receptor in colonic motor dysfunction associated with bowel inflammation in rats

2014

Background and Purpose Recent evidence indicates an involvement of P2X7 purinergic receptor (P2X7R) in the fine tuning of immune functions, as well as in driving enteric neuron apoptosis under intestinal inflammation. However, the participation of this receptor in the regulation of enteric neuromuscular functions remains undetermined. This study was aimed at investigating the role of P2X7Rs in the control of colonic motility in experimental colitis. Experimental Approach Colitis was induced in rats by 2,4-dinitrobenzenesulfonic acid. P2X7R distribution was examined by immunofluorescence analysis. Increased risk for nonmelanoma skin cancers in patients who receive thiopurines for inflammatory bowel disease.

2011

International audience; BACKGROUND & AIMS: Patients with inflammatory bowel disease (IBD) who have been exposed to thiopurines might have an increased risk of skin cancer. We assessed this risk among patients in France. METHODS: We performed a prospective observational cohort study of 19,486 patients with IBD, enrolled from May 2004 to June 2005, who were followed up until December 31, 2007. The incidence of nonmelanoma skin cancer (NMSC) in the general population, used for reference, was determined from the French Network of Cancer Registries.
